Section 14 Adjusting and Setting up Equipment (for Services)
14-6
14.2.3 Adjusting a radar performance monitor
To adjust a radar transmitting/receiving status, use the [Performance Monitor] dialogue or the
[Performance Monitor (SSR)] dialogue.
[Operation procedure]
Open the radar transmitting/receiving status adjustment screen by performing the following menu
operations.
[Menu] button Service Adjustment MON / MON (SSR)
14.2.3.1 Displaying the [Performance Monitor]/[Performance
Monitor (SSR)] dialogue
When [MON] is selected in the classification pane, the [Performance Monitor] dialogue (when a
magnetron radar is used) or the [Performance Monitor (SSR)] dialogue (when a solid-state radar is
used) is displayed. The items to be displayed change according to the type of the radar antenna.
Memo
When the radar is in the Slave mode, the [Performance Monitor] dialogue (or [Performance
Monitor (SSR)] dialogue) is disabled.
If a master unit other than straight connection is being set in interswitch setting, the
"Performance Monitor" screen (or "Performance Monitor (SSR) " screen) is disabled (may
also be enabled depending on the equipment setting.).
When the [Performance Monitor] dialogue is displayed, the sector blank in the PPI screen is
hidden. When the solid state radar antenna is connected, the PM sector is displayed; in the
case of the magnetron radar, the sector is not displayed.
While adjusting the performance monitor, TGT acquisition is not cancell
ed by the target
tracking function.
If a TGT symbol is displayed inside a pattern of the performance monitor and adjusting is
difficult, cancel TGT acquisition once.
